Use trigonometric identities to find the exact value sin 10° cos 50° + cos 10° sin 50°

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

Sin A Cos B + Cos A Sin B = Sin (A +B)

Sin 10 cos 50  + Cos 10 Sin 50 = Sin (10 + 50) = Sin 60 = √3/2
